INFORMATION ABOUT COOKIES

Cookies are small text files that websites visited by the user send to his computer or mobile device, where they are stored before being sent back to the same websites when they are next visited. It is thanks to cookies that the website remembers the actions and preferences of the user (like, for example, login data, language, font size, other visual settings, etc.) in such a way that they do not have to be given again when the user re-visits the website or moves from one page to another within this. Cookies are therefore used to authenticate online users, monitor browsing sessions and store information on the activities of the users that visit a website, and may also contain a unique identification number that enables us to keep track of the browsing sessions of the user within the website for statistical or advertising purposes. While browsing within a site, the user may also receive cookies on his computer or mobile device from websites or web servers other than those he is visiting (so-called ‘third party’ cookies). Some operations cannot be performed without the use of cookies, which, in certain cases are therefore technically necessary for the website to function.

There are different types of cookies, with different characteristics and functions, and they can remain on the computer or mobile device of the user for different periods of time: there are so-called ‘session cookies’, which are automatically deleted when the browser is closed, and so-called ‘persistent cookies’, which remain on the user’s device until a pre-established time when they expire.

According to legislation currently in force in Italy, the express consent of the user is not always required for the use of cookies. In particular, so-called ‘technical’ cookies, i.e. those used for the sole purpose of sending a communication over an electronic network, or insofar as is strictly necessary to provide the service explicitly requested by the user, do not require such consent. These are, in other words, cookies that are essential for the functioning of the website or necessary to perform the tasks requested by the user.

Among technical cookies, which do not require express consent for their use, the Italian Data Protection Authority (see. General Provision ‘Identification of the simplified procedures for the disclosure of information and the acquisition of consent for the use of cookies – 8 May 2014”) also includes:

analytics cookies, when used directly by the website manager to collect information, in aggregate form, on the number of users and how they visit the website,
browsing or session cookies (for authentication, to make a purchase, etc.),
functional cookies, which allow the user to browse according to a set of selected criteria (for example, language, products selected for purchase) in order to improve the service provided to the user.

For so-called user profiling cookies, on the other hand, i.e. those aimed at creating profiles for the user and used to send advertising messages in line with the preferences selected by the user while browsing the net, prior consent is required.
